Fazekas Sándor: Hungarian winemaking is before a quality change
The Hungarian winemaking industry is experiencing a quality change of era. In the past few years the possibility of a quantitative and qualitative move forward in the industry – said the Minister of Agriculture on Thursday.
Fazekas Sándor Minister of Agriculture stressed that the result of many years of work has occured last year: the output of the sector amounted to 73 billion HUF, 39 percent more than in the previous year. (MTI)
